L9925 by STMicroelectronics

L9925 by STMicroelectronics is a MOSFET Gate Driver with 2 functions, BCD technology, and Full Bridge based interface IC type. It operates at supply voltages b/w 9V to 16V, with turn-on/off times of 50 us. This driver is commonly used in applications requiring high side drivers and small outline packages.

Manufacturer Highlights

STMicroelectronics

STMicroelectronics is a global leader in the semiconductor manufacturing industry, with over 35 years of experience providing innovative and advanced technologies for customers around the world. Headquartered in Netherlands, STMicroelectronics has more than 51,323 employees worldwide and operates across 32 countries all over Europe, Asia-Pacific and the Americas. The company’s portfolio includes integrated circuits, discrete components, application-specific standard products, and computer chipsets. STMicroelectronics serves a wide range of industries such as automotive, consumer markets, healthcare and industrial applications.
